What Exactly is a Shiver?

If you’re picturing a group of penguins huddling together in the cold, think again. A shiver is actually the term used to describe a group of sharks. That’s right—those sleek, powerful predators of the deep have their own unique collective noun. It’s not as cuddly as a “herd” or as cozy as a “flock,” but it’s undeniably fitting for these awe-inspiring creatures.

Why Call It a Shiver?

Now, you might be wondering, “Why on earth would anyone call a group of sharks a shiver?” It’s a fair question. The term likely stems from the spine-tingling sensation you’d feel if you spotted a group of sharks gliding through the water. Sharks have a reputation for being fierce and formidable, and encountering multiple at once? Well, that’s enough to send shivers down anyone’s spine—hence the name.

But let’s be honest, it’s also kind of poetic, isn’t it? The word “shiver” captures both the physical reaction and the mystique surrounding these incredible animals.

Other Fun Animal Group Names

While we’re on the topic of quirky collective nouns, let’s take a quick detour to explore some other fascinating animal group names. The animal kingdom is full of these gems, and they range from the poetic to the downright bizarre. Here are a few of my favorites:

  • A murder of crows: Crows are often associated with mystery and darkness, so it’s no surprise their group name has a spooky vibe. Imagine a flock of crows cawing in unison—it’s like something straight out of a Gothic novel.
  • An exaltation of larks: This one’s pure poetry. Larks are known for their beautiful songs, and the term “exaltation” perfectly captures the joy and wonder of hearing them sing in flight.
  • A pride of lions: Lions are the kings and queens of the savanna, so it’s only fitting that their group name reflects their regal status. A pride of lions just sounds majestic, doesn’t it?

These names aren’t just fun to say—they also give us a glimpse into how humans have historically viewed and interacted with these animals.
